编程游戏机怎么玩的

时间:2025-01-24 19:50:43 游戏攻略

编程游戏机是一种结合了编程技术和游戏设计的设备,它允许用户通过编写程序来创建和玩自己的游戏。以下是编程游戏机的主要玩法和特点:

硬件组成

编程游戏机通常由中央处理器(CPU)、内存、图形处理器(GPU)、存储器、显示屏、输入设备(如键盘、控制器)等组件构成。这些组件共同工作,使得游戏机能够处理输入信号、计算和渲染游戏图像,以及输出图像和音频。

软件开发

编程游戏机的软件开发涉及编写游戏的代码、设计游戏的图形和音频效果,以及创建游戏的逻辑和规则。游戏开发者可以使用各种编程语言和开发工具,如C++、Unity、Unreal Engine等,来开发游戏。

游戏引擎

编程游戏机通常使用游戏引擎来简化开发过程。游戏引擎是一个软件框架,提供了游戏开发所需的各种功能和工具,如图形渲染、物理模拟、碰撞检测等。流行的游戏引擎包括Unity、Unreal Engine、Godot等。

交互式编程环境

编程游戏机提供了一个交互式的编程环境,让玩家能够以编程的方式来控制游戏的行为和规则。玩家可以使用编程语言或图形化编程工具来创建游戏角色、设定游戏规则、设计关卡等。

教育资源

编程游戏机通常提供了一些教育资源和教程,帮助玩家学习编程的基础知识和技巧。这些资源可以帮助初学者快速掌握编程的基本概念和技巧,如算法、逻辑和问题解决能力。

开放性

编程游戏机提供了一个开放的平台,允许玩家自由地修改游戏的内容和规则。玩家可以通过编程语言来改变游戏的场景、角色、动作等,实现自己的创意和想法。

自由度

编程游戏机提供了丰富的工具和资源,使玩家能够自由地创作和定制游戏。玩家可以设计自己的关卡、角色、道具等,制作出独特的游戏体验。

学习性

编程游戏机可以帮助玩家学习编程和逻辑思维。通过编写游戏代码,玩家可以了解编程的基本原理和逻辑结构,提高解决问题的能力和创造力。

社交性

编程游戏机通常具有社交功能,玩家可以与其他玩家分享自己创作的游戏,或者参与其他玩家的游戏。这种社交互动可以增加游戏的乐趣和可玩性。

可玩性

编程游戏机不仅可以用来编程创作,还可以作为一台普通的游戏机来玩预先设计好的游戏。这种多功能性使得编程游戏机既适合教育,也适合娱乐。

示例:使用Microbit和makecode编程游戏机

所需硬件

ikbit(microbit插针版)

BIT-摇杆传感器

BIT-LCD5110显示屏

连接硬件

将ikbit和BIT模块连接起来,并通过地址添加ikbit扩展包。

编写代码

打开makecode,通过拖拽图形块来实现游戏机的功能。例如,开始让LCD进入游戏模式,下面的无限循环不断获取摇杆数据,来控制游戏的上下左右。

运行游戏

连接到电视或显示器上,运行编写的代码,享受自己创作的游戏。

通过以上步骤,用户可以轻松地创建和玩自己的游戏,同时学习编程的基本知识和技能。编程游戏机不仅提供了乐趣,还激发了用户的创造力和解决问题的能力。